Question:

Are steel channels suitable for data center construction?

Answer:

Data center construction can benefit greatly from the use of steel channels. These channels, also known as C-channels, possess the necessary qualities of strength, stability, and flexibility required for such projects. Their durability and ability to withstand heavy loads make them a popular choice for framing walls, ceilings, and floors. The advantages of using steel channels in data center construction are numerous. Firstly, their exceptional load-bearing capabilities enable them to support the weight of server racks, equipment, and infrastructure. In data centers with high equipment density and significant server and networking device weights, this is of utmost importance. Furthermore, steel channels contribute to the structural stability of a data center, ensuring its security and strength. They are resistant to bending and buckling, providing a solid framework capable of withstanding both internal and external forces. This is particularly beneficial in areas prone to seismic activities or extreme weather conditions. In addition, steel channels allow for easy installation of various utilities necessary in data centers, such as electrical wiring, cable trays, and cooling systems. They can be designed with pre-punched holes or slots, simplifying the routing of cables and pipes throughout the facility. Moreover, steel channels offer versatility in design and construction. They can be easily modified and adjusted to meet specific layout requirements, facilitating efficient use of space and flexibility for future expansions or modifications. This adaptability is crucial in data centers where technology and infrastructure needs are constantly evolving. In conclusion, steel channels are undeniably suitable for data center construction. Their strength, stability, flexibility, and versatility make them an ideal choice for creating a robust and efficient infrastructure to support the critical operations of a data center.
